First and foremost, choosing the right cut of beef is crucial. For bistec de carne, a lean cut such as sirloin or ribeye is ideal. These cuts have a good balance of marbling, which contributes to the steak’s tenderness and juiciness. Ensure that the beef is at room temperature before cooking, as this allows it to cook more evenly.
Next, let’s talk about seasoning. A well-seasoned bistec de carne is the key to its deliciousness. Start by patting the steak dry with paper towels to remove any excess moisture. This will help the seasonings adhere better to the meat. In a small bowl, mix together salt, pepper, and any additional spices you prefer, such as garlic powder, onion powder, or chili powder. Rub the mixture all over the steak, making sure to cover both sides evenly.
Once the steak is seasoned, it’s time to cook it. Preheat a grill or a large skillet over medium-high heat. If using a grill, oil the grates to prevent the steak from sticking. If using a skillet, add a generous amount of oil and heat it until it shimmers. Place the steak on the grill or in the skillet and cook for about 3-4 minutes on each side for medium-rare, or until it reaches your desired level of doneness. Remember to use tongs to flip the steak, as a fork can pierce the meat and cause it to lose juices.
After cooking, let the steak rest for a few minutes before slicing it against the grain. This allows the juices to redistribute throughout the meat, resulting in a more tender and flavorful steak. Slice the steak into thin strips and serve it with your favorite sides, such as a salad, potatoes, or rice.
